"Journal of Thermoelectricity" publishes original papers and invited reviews on the research and developments in various thermoelectric fields:
- general problems (prospects of thermoelectricity, reviews, historical issues);
- theory (thermoelectric effects, thermoelectric materials, energy converters, devices and instruments);
- material research (thermoelectric material properties, methods of material design and improving material properties);
- technologies (thermoelectric materials, energy converters (modules), thermoelectric products);
- design (methods of thermoelectric products design, computer design methods in thermoelectricity; results of thermoelectric products design);
- metrology and standardization (methods and equipment for determining the properties of thermoelectric materials and energy converters (modules); methods and equipment for testing thermoelectric products; standards in thermoelectricity);
- reliability (theory of reliability of thermoelectric elements and systems, reliability test methods and equipment, reliability test results);
- thermoelectric products (cooling modules, generator modules, thermoelectric coolers, thermoelectric generators, thermoelectric measuring instruments, other thermoelectric products);
- news (personalia, surveys of conferences, seminars, exhibitions; new patents; new books and collections; dissertations; information of International Thermoelectric Academy, presentations of thermoelectric organizations, training specialists in thermoelectricity);
- advertisement
"Journal of Thermoelectricity" is a quarterly published in Ukrainian, Russian and English languages (concurrently).

Requirements to papers:
- papers that result from research performed in scientific institutions or at the enterprises should be sent to the editors with a letter from the organization where the work was performed;
- papers should be submitted in English in duplicate on A4 paper sheets; the number of lines on a page should not exceed 28;
- the title of the paper should be concrete and at the same time possibly concise;
- dimensions of all the magnitudes used in the paper should be expressed in SI system, and the symbols used should be clarified;
- figures and pictures should be clear and contrast; diagram axes must be parallel to sheet boundaries, thus eliminating the possibility of angle shift when scaling;
- equations should be typed within the text (special attention must be paid to correct writing of superscripts and subscripts); formulae numbers should be given in parentheses to the right;
- references should appear at the end of the manuscript. References within the text should be enclosed in square brackets. References should be numbered in order of first appearance in the text. Examples of various reference types are given below.
- Journal paper: author (last name first, followed by initials), title of the paper, title of the journal, issue, year, page number (first paper page).
- Book: author (last name first, followed by initials), title of the book, volume, city, publishers, year, number of pages.
- Patent: Bengen M.E., German Patent Appl. OZ 123, 438, 1940; German Patent 869,070, 1953, Tech. Oil Mission Reel, 143, 135, 1946.
- If there are several authors, all the names and initials should be indicated. The abbreviation "et al." should not be used;
- papers should be signed by all the authors.
Paper should be supplemented by:
- letter from the organization where the work was performed or from the authors of the work applying for the publication of the paper;
- information on the author (authors): last name and initials in Ukrainian, Russian and English; full name and postal address of the institution where the author works; telephone number; E-mail;
- author's (authors') photo in black and white;
- abstract (not exceeding 200 words);
